Picnic on 19 May at Elk Grove Park , 10:00 AM

OK everyone, it's that time of year again. What's Spring without a Titan/Armada Picnic ?? Sooooooo, we're in the planning stages of our latest gathering of Titans and Armadas. We selected the Elk Grove Park because it seems to be a good central location, and because we've had great participation there in the past. For those who don't live in the Sacramento area and would like to attend the park is just off Highway 99, south of Sacramento in Elk Grove. ELK GROVE REGIONAL PARK

Elk Grove Regional Park is located at 9950 Elk Grove-Florin Road. Take Highway 99 South from downtown Sacramento to Elk Grove Boulevard, and then turn left. Turn right onto Elk Grove-Florin Rd. and the park is just past Elk Grove High School on the right.

While there are some fixed B-B-Q's and tables, it would be best if we can come up with some B-B-Q's, tables, chairs and shade tents. So if anyone can volunteer, please let me know. We would also like volunteers for food items, and would like a best guess count on participants. If I've forgotten anything please let me know and I'll add that. I've requested that this be a sticky so that we can keep it updated and convenient for everyone to monitor.

This is a family oriented gathering, so don't hesisitate to bring the whole family. Glass bottles are not allowed, so bring what you want to drink in cans ( I know Dawgs, you prefer bottles, but !!!!!), and if you have folding tables and chairs please bring them along.
